Today we had a get together with Grandma and Grandpa Blaylock. We met at Arizona Mills mall. We had lunch and then went to the new Sea Life Aquarium.....
It was a blast!!! It was a lot cooler than we expected for an aqaurium in the mall.

They had lots of peek holes where the kids could climb inside the tank without getting wet and get up close and personal with the fish.



They also had a hands on tank with Starfish and Shrimp, it was cool the kids got to touch the starfish but the shrimp were a little skiddish....





There were lots of different tanks with hundreds of species of fish. It was fun to watch the kids eyes light up. They had seen most of these fish when we went to Sea World, but it was a totally different experience and they were SO excited to be there....





They had a room with one large tank in it where you could go up above it and look in, as well as go into the peek holes on the side (and behind) to get a better view. It was filled with beautiful colorful coral and sting rays, as well as some other species of fish.....





They loved stopping at the peek holes every chance they got : )



And we stopped to watched a video on ocean life too....


The highlight for Sean was getting to walk through the Shark tunnel and be surrounded by the sharks and fish. They also had some BIG bones which he called the Dino in the tank as well. The tank was above and below as well as both sides. It was a cool feeling to be walking on the glass and look down at the fish below.....





They had a standing C shaped Aquarium where you could walk behind and feel like you were inside : )



They were surprised that the jellyfish were as small as they were....
